Linux对Pentium 4服务器GRUB引导加载程序禁用超线程
时间:2020-01-09 10:41:27 来源:igfitidea点击:
问题描述:我正在使用GRUB引导加载程序。
如何禁用奔腾4服务器的超线程?
我正在使用CentOS。
解决方法:为了提高过去的性能,在软件中启用了线程处理,方法是将指令拆分为多个流,以便多个处理器可以对它们进行操作。
超线程技术(HT技术)在每个处理器上提供线程级并行性,从而可以更有效地利用处理器资源,提高处理吞吐量,并改善当今的多线程软件的性能。
如果禁用HT,您可能会注意到性能问题。
要禁用编辑grub.conf文件:
# vi /etc/grub.conf
或者
# vi /boot/grub/menu.lst
找到要修改的内核行,并在末尾追加noht:
kernel /boot/vmlinuz-2.6.8-2-686 root=/dev/hdb1 ro single noht
保存并关闭文件。
您也可以在启动CentOS Linux期间禁用HT。
您需要将一个选项传递给内核。
- 在GRUB菜单上
- 选择要引导的内核。
- 输入
e
修改内核 - 在行尾追加
noht
。 - 按回车键启动此选项。
- 输入
b
引导到该内核。